Dedicated Web Hosting

What is dedicated web hosting and who should be using it? Have you ever asked yourself those questions? From what it is, to its advantages and disadvantages, to the costs, this article is here to help you out with some of the major questions surrounding dedicated web hosting. By the end, you’ll have a better idea as to what it is and whether or not it’s for you.

What it is is a type of web hosting that allows webmasters – either individuals or businesses – to lease pre-configured equipment and connectivity from a hosting service provider. What that means in English is simply this: instead of sharing a whole bunch of server space with other people, you will be able to lease an entire one for yourself. What good does that do? Why would somebody need an entire server to themselves?

Well, first of all, because you have the whole thing to yourself, the costs necessarily go up. But, people who do it swear that the benefits outweigh the costs. First, they have more control. If anything goes wrong with your site, you have only yourself to blame. But, on the other hand, you no longer have to worry about someone else crashing the same server that you’re on.

Dedicated web hosting also lets your visitors experience faster load times. The server is only dealing with requests from your site and no one else’s, so there will be no virtual line, so to speak, for websites. Plus, you no longer have to worry about any bandwidth penalty. People who use this service generally need a lot of bandwidth in the first place, so no restrictions are set on your usage.

The benefits of this type of hosting program are many, but they usually boil down to two key aspects: control and reliability. On the flip side of the coin, however, lie the disadvantages. One disadvantage in particular stops people dead in their tracks once they uncover it, and that is cost.

Although the price of this kind of service is continually coming down thanks to the growth in popularity of it, it is still on the high side. In the past, typical prices have ranged anywhere from a few hundred dollars to a few thousand dollars per month. While that has come down a bit in recent times, it is still expensive.

Another disadvantage of dedicated web hosting is the amount of technical skill needed to see it through. Since you have almost total control that means you also have to look out for hackers, troubleshoot any system problems, install and configure programs, and more. If you don’t have the necessary administration skills, it could just wind up giving you more headaches and costing you more in the long run.

As a small business owner, you need to decide if this type of program is best for your site or not. What kind of resources, flexibility and customization do you need to run your business online? Do you have the skills to handle it on your own?
